  • RICE is Out, Now What?
    Dr. Gabe Mirkin, a physician and author coined the term RICE in his book for athletes that published in 1978. Over 40 years later rest, ice, elevation, and compression, still appears to be the most common recommended treatment for sports or recreation related injuries amongst coaches, parent, and many healthcare providers, although that is changing.   • The Best Way to Treat Trigger Points
    Trigger points are described as taut bands of skeletal muscle. When they cannot relax, these fibers create a nodule or what is more commonly called a “knot”. Trigger points do often show up in areas around where there is injury or chronic tension. That tension may be created by dehydration, emotional stress, repetitive movements, poor postures, protective patterns related an area with any underlying condition (whether it be from the musculoskeletal or other organ systems).
